Explanation / Answer
Ans:
Normal distribution:
z critical(One tail)
z=NORMSINV(0.95)=1.645
z=NORMSINV(0.05)=-1.645
z critical two tail(for 0.05 significance level)
z=NORMSINV(0.025)=-1.96
z=NORMSINV(0.975)=1.96
Probability(P tails):
P(z<1.645)=NORMSDIST(1.645)=0.95
P(z<-1.645)=NORMSDIST(-1.645)=0.05
F distribution:
P(F<=2.4773)=FDIST(2.4773,60,60)=0.0003
F critical one tail(0.05)=FINV(0.05,60,60)=1.5343
